
First and foremost, it is important to set clear goals for yourself. What do you want to achieve? Whether it is becoming a manager at work, starting your own business, or improving your physical fitness, having a clear goal in mind will give you direction and motivation. Break down your goal into smaller, manageable steps and create a plan to achieve them. This will help you stay focused and organized along the way.
In order to get ahead, you need to continue learning and expanding your knowledge and skills. Take advantage of various learning opportunities such as workshops, seminars, and online courses. Not only will this enhance your abilities and make you more marketable, but it will also show your dedication and commitment to personal growth. Additionally, seek feedback and guidance from mentors or successful individuals in your field. Their insights and advice can provide valuable perspectives and help you avoid common pitfalls.
Networking is another crucial aspect of getting ahead. Building relationships with like-minded individuals and industry professionals can open doors to new opportunities and valuable connections. Attend networking events, join professional organizations, and utilize online platforms such as LinkedIn to expand your network. Remember to always maintain a positive and professional image, as people are more likely to help those they trust and respect.
One of the most important aspects of getting ahead is hard work and perseverance. Success rarely comes overnight, and setbacks are inevitable. However, it is important to stay committed and resilient in the face of challenges. Be willing to put in the time and effort required to achieve your goals, and never give up. Remember that failure is often a stepping stone towards success, and each setback is an opportunity to learn and grow.
Lastly, remember to take care of yourself. Maintaining a healthy work-life balance is essential for long-term success. Make time for self-care activities such as exercise, relaxation, and spending quality time with loved ones. Taking breaks and recharging will not only benefit your well-being but also enhance your productivity and creativity.
